Investigation of engineering properties of pomace ash additive mortars

Özet (EN)
Tons of waste is generated every day in all areas of industry and in our daily life around the world. Waste is a big problem because of the damage it causes to the environment and human health. Efforts are being made to prevent the formation of wastes primarily for this problem. There are also recycling studies for wastes that cannot be prevented. Wastes arising in many areas are used in various sectors and recycled. There are also studies in the construction sector for the recycling of various wastes. These studies partially bring solutions to eliminate the waste problem. This study was made for the recycling of agricultural waste, rice. In the study, olive ash remaining from pomace used as fuel was used. The engineering properties of pomace ash-added mortars were produced. Mortar samples were produced by substituting %5, %10, %12, %15, %20 ve %25 pomace ash instead of cement. Tests were applied to the mortar samples in fresh and hardened state. While fresh unit weight and spreading tests were applied in fresh state, pressure, bending, capillary water absorption tests were applied in the hardened state. The engineering properties of the olive pomace ash added mortars obtained as a result of the study were compared with the fly ash added mortar samples, which is an industrial waste.
